A calf strain is an injury involving one or more of the calf muscles and causes pain at the back of the lower leg.🦵

Calf strains are commonly seen in running sports such as ⚽️ soccer ,  🏈rugby, netball and 🏀 basketball. Calf strains  often occur when attempting to accelerate from a stationary position, or when jumping or lunging forward. The calf muscles 🦵can also be injured as a result of overuse. Repetitive jumping, long distance running 🏃🏽‍♂️or walking, 🚶‍♂️especially up hills or on uneven surfaces can increase the risk of a calf strain.

Patients can feel various symptoms when injured with a calf strain. The most common symptoms of a calf strain are:.

-Sudden sharp pain or stabbing sensation at the back of the lower leg 🧐

-The feeling as if you have been hit in the back of the leg🦵

-You may hear an audible pop 🥴

-The calf muscle will be tender to touch

-Swelling or bruising may occur depending on the severity of the calf strain 😳

-Inability to weight bear on the affected leg in severe calf strains
